In the Victorian era, fashion was intricately detailed and highly decorative. One of the iconic accessories of this time period was the witch hat. The Victorian witch hat was a prominent piece of headwear that became synonymous with mysticism and witchcraft. These hats were typically made from black felt or velvet and had a cone-shaped design. Their tall, pointed structure was a key characteristic that differentiated them from other hats of the era. The height of the hat varied, with some reaching up to 18 inches or more.

These decorations were often in darker shades, such as deep purple or burgundy, to enhance the aura of mystery and enchantment. The addition of veils or tulle made the hat even more elaborate and added an extra layer of allure. Despite their association with witchcraft, Victorian witch hats were not exclusively worn by witches or those interested in the occult. These hats were popular among fashion-forward women of the time who wanted to make a bold fashion statement. They were worn for special occasions, such as masquerade balls or theatrical performances, where their exaggerated silhouette and dark allure created a captivating presence. The Victorian witch hat has since become an enduring symbol of both the Victorian era and Halloween. Its distinct shape and the air of mystique it exudes make it instantly recognizable. Today, these hats are still widely worn as part of witch or wizard costumes during Halloween celebrations or themed events.
